Supporting your teen with endometriosis
Adolescence is a time of change as a child grows into an adult. Starting periods is one of these changes, and for some young people it can bring unexpected pain. For some young people, this pain may be a sign of early endometriosis, a condition where tissue similar to the lining of the uterus grows outside the uterus.
This fact sheet explains what endometriosis is, how you can support your teen and where to find help.
